American vs. European Roulette: Which Suits Your Style?

Before placing a real money wager, it helps to understand the two main versions of roulette you’ll encounter online. The most obvious difference is the wheel itself. American roulette has 38 pockets: numbers 1 through 36, plus a single zero and a double zero. European roulette has 37 pockets – only a single zero. That extra slot shifts the house edge from 2.7% in European roulette to 5.26% in American roulette. Over many spins, the difference significantly impacts your bankroll.

If you prefer lower risk and better odds, European roulette is the smarter play. Many online casinos also offer French roulette, which uses the European wheel but adds the en prison and la partage rules that return half your bet on even-money wagers when the ball lands on zero. Live Dealer Roulette: The Next Best Thing to Being There

Live dealer roulette has revolutionized online gaming. Instead of a computer-generated spin, you watch a real human dealer spin a physical wheel in a professional studio. High-definition cameras capture every angle, and you place your bets using an on-screen interface. The dealer announces results in real time, and a chat feature lets you interact with them and other players. For Texans who miss the banter and the tactile sound of the ball bouncing, live roulette delivers an experience that pure RNG games cannot match.

The technical requirements are modest – a stable internet connection and a device with a modern browser or app are all you need. Many live roulette tables stream in 4K, with multiple camera views, including a close-up of the wheel and a replay of each spin. Most platforms allow you to adjust betting limits, choose classic or speed rounds, and even track statistics for hot and cold numbers.
